Wireless printing has become essential for both home and office use because it allows you to print from multiple devices without using cables. If you are trying how to connect hp deskjet printer to wifi the process is simple and can be completed using a few different methods depending on your printer model.

Wireless Setup Mode Method

To connect using wireless setup mode, first turn on your printer and make sure it is ready. Then press and hold the Wireless and Cancel (X) buttons together until the wireless light starts blinking. This indicates that the printer has entered setup mode. After that, you can use the HP Smart app on your mobile phone or computer to select your WiFi network and enter the password to complete the setup.

HP Smart App Method

The HP Smart App is the most recommended method for connecting your printer to WiFi. You need to install the HP Smart App on your smartphone or PC and open it. After launching the app, select the option “Add Printer” and follow the instructions shown on the screen. When prompted, enter your WiFi credentials, and the app will automatically complete the connection process. Once successful, you will see a confirmation message.

WPS Method for Quick Connection

If you want a faster method without entering a password, you can use the WPS method. For this, press the WPS button on your WiFi router and within two minutes press the Wireless button on your printer. The printer will automatically connect to the network once the process is complete, and the wireless light will remain stable.

Requirements Before Setup

Before starting the setup process, make sure that your WiFi router is working properly and connected to the internet. Your printer should be turned on, and your device (mobile or computer) should be connected to the same WiFi network that you want to use for the printer. You should also have the correct WiFi name and password ready.

Common Issues and Troubleshooting

If your printer is not connecting, restarting your printer, router, and device can often solve the issue. It is also important to ensure that you are using a 2.4GHz WiFi network, as many HP printers do not support 5GHz networks. If the issue still continues, reinstalling the HP Smart App or resetting the wireless setup on the printer can help fix the problem.

Tips for Stable Connection

To maintain a stable connection, it is recommended to keep your printer within close range of the router, ideally within five to ten feet. Avoid using sleep or auto-off modes that may disconnect the printer from the network. Keeping your printer firmware updated and using the HP Smart App for setup also helps ensure a smooth and stable connection.
